Using ensemble of ensemble machine learning methods to predict outcomes of cardiac resynchronization.
Introduction: The efficacy of cardiac resynchronization therapy (CRT) has been widely studied in the medical literature; however, about 30% of candidates fail to respond to this treatment strategy.
